Tester calls are kind of a hard beast because even seasoned shops have a hard time getting testers. Sometimes the pattern just doesn’t speak to people which I’ve had happen. Other times it has more to do with timing. The holidays are here so a lot of people are busy with that. Beginning of the school year, school exams, etc can also have a huge impact since many crocheters on here are minors.

Be sure to post your tester calls in the general and craft chats but otherwise there’s not much else you can do. You can always wait a few weeks and post a new tester call to see if more people are available. A few designers have done this and had better success in getting enough testers.

The ONLY shops that don’t have this problem are the super huge designers. Everyone has this problem sadly :sweat_smile:
